You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
gentoo-overlay/net-mail/fetchmail/files/fetchmail-gss_c_nt_hostbase...

22 lines
963 B

Gentoo bug #389347
--- configure.ac.orig 2011-08-21 13:35:05.000000000 +0000
+++ configure.ac 2011-11-06 19:46:07.000000000 +0000
@@ -893,11 +893,12 @@
CPPFLAGS="$CPPFLAGS -I$with_gssapi/include"
fi
AC_CHECK_HEADERS(gss.h gssapi.h gssapi/gssapi.h gssapi/gssapi_generic.h)
- if test "$ac_cv_header_gssapi_h" = "yes"; then
- AC_EGREP_HEADER(GSS_C_NT_HOSTBASED_SERVICE, gssapi.h, AC_DEFINE(HAVE_GSS_C_NT_HOSTBASED_SERVICE,1,Define if you have MIT kerberos))
- else
- AC_EGREP_HEADER(GSS_C_NT_HOSTBASED_SERVICE, gssapi/gssapi.h, AC_DEFINE(HAVE_GSS_C_NT_HOSTBASED_SERVICE))
- fi
+ AC_EGREP_CPP(hostbased_service_gss_nt_yes, gssapi.h,
+ [#include <gssapi.h>
+ #ifdef GSS_C_NT_HOSTBASED_SERVICE
+ hostbased_service_gss_nt_yes
+ #endif],
+ AC_DEFINE(HAVE_GSS_C_NT_HOSTBASED_SERVICE,1,Define if your GSSAPI implemantation defines GSS_C_NT_HOSTBASED_SERVICE))
fi])
dnl ,------------------------------------------------------------------